I Love Books!

As a writer, I naturally love books. New books. Old books. Big books, small. Ebooks, paperbacks--I love them all. I love to read books. I enjoy writing them. I love to buy books, borrow books and trade them back and forth. Books make excellent gifts, both to receive and give away.

I love the smell of a new book, and the way the crisp pages rustle when I turn them. The smell of an old book is even better, and the way the worn pages feel between my fingers—fragile and soft. I like to think about the people who read the book before me. Was this one of their favorites? Is that why it's so dog-eared? Or was the book owned by many different people? Moving from reader to reader, from place to place. Who bought it and when? And I'm always in awe thinking about the authors who actually wrote the older books, back in the day before computers. It boggles the mind.

Not only do I love books, I love bookstores, too. New bookstores, used bookstores and how about libraries? Oh yeah. Aisles and aisles of books. Shelves upon shelves of countless books. All ready to be picked up and read. Pored over and studied. Savored and enjoyed.

Books not only give me reading and writing pleasure, they give me esthetic pleasure, too. I love to decorate with books. In my opinion, a room without books is a cold, unfriendly place. Almost every room in my house holds bookshelves full of books. I have small groupings of books decoratively placed under lamps, on table tops and even on the floor. Books not only hold the promise of wonderful stories between their covers, they beckon me with their warmth, inviting me to sit down and make myself comfortable.

I love to be surrounded by books. My keeper shelf holds old favorites, and I continually add new finds. When I'm down and feeling blue, I rely on my "comfort" reads to help pull me through. Old books are like old friends. They're always there when you need them.

I can't imagine my life without books. I have a t-shirt with the slogan: So many books . . . So little time. So true.
